If you use a stick to push an object, the muscular force acting on the object is a non contact force since your body is not in contact with the object. True or False? Explain.

False.
Contact forces are those forces in which direct contact between the two bodies is required. The contact may also be with the help of a stick or a piece of rope.
If we use a stick to push an object, we have made the contact with the help of stick. This push or force is caused by the action of muscles in our body. This muscular force is a contact force.
